11'use strict' ;
2- var common = require ( '../common' ) ;
3- var assert = require ( 'assert' ) ;
2+ const common = require ( '../common' ) ;
3+ const assert = require ( 'assert' ) ;
44
55if ( ! common . hasCrypto ) {
66 common . skip ( 'missing crypto' ) ;
77 return ;
88}
9- var tls = require ( 'tls' ) ;
9+ const tls = require ( 'tls' ) ;
1010
11- var fs = require ( 'fs' ) ;
11+ const fs = require ( 'fs' ) ;
1212
13- var server = tls . createServer ( {
13+ const server = tls . createServer ( {
1414 key : fs . readFileSync ( common . fixturesDir + '/keys/0-dns-key.pem' ) ,
1515 cert : fs . readFileSync ( common . fixturesDir + '/keys/0-dns-cert.pem' )
1616} , function ( c ) {
@@ -19,16 +19,16 @@ var server = tls.createServer({
1919 server . close ( ) ;
2020 } ) ;
2121} ) . listen ( 0 , common . mustCall ( function ( ) {
22- var c = tls . connect ( this . address ( ) . port , {
22+ const c = tls . connect ( this . address ( ) . port , {
2323 rejectUnauthorized : false
2424 } , common . mustCall ( function ( ) {
25- var cert = c . getPeerCertificate ( ) ;
26- assert . equal ( cert . subjectaltname ,
27- 'DNS:google.com\0.evil.com, ' +
28- 'DNS:just-another.com, ' +
29- 'IP Address:8.8.8.8, ' +
30- 'IP Address:8.8.4.4, ' +
31- 'DNS:last.com' ) ;
25+ const cert = c . getPeerCertificate ( ) ;
26+ assert . strictEqual ( cert . subjectaltname ,
27+ 'DNS:google.com\0.evil.com, ' +
28+ 'DNS:just-another.com, ' +
29+ 'IP Address:8.8.8.8, ' +
30+ 'IP Address:8.8.4.4, ' +
31+ 'DNS:last.com' ) ;
3232 c . write ( 'ok' ) ;
3333 } ) ) ;
3434} ) ) ;
0 commit comments